Go vows to sustain pandemic recovery push, Rody’s legacy

Presidential aspirant Sen. Christopher “Bong” Go on Monday vowed to continue efforts towards pandemic recovery, solidifying the Duterte legacy and protecting the future of the nation.

He also reminded his fellow candidates to “take into heart” the reason why they chose to seek public office —to provide genuine public service to the people.

“There is nothing greater than serving our fellow Filipinos with utmost sincerity and loyalty,” he said.

“When the dust settles and after all has been said and done, what is important is that the Filipino people should eventually be the winner in this exercise of democracy,” he added.

On Nov. 13, Go substituted for Grepor Belgica and filed his candidacy as the standard-bearer of the Pederalismo ng Dugong Dakilang Samahan for the presidency in the 2022 polls.

He was personally accompanied by President Rodrigo Duterte in the Commission on Elections main office in Intramuros, Manila.

He said the challenge is to “save the legacy of President Duterte, pursue further the positive change we have started, and protect the future of our people.”

“The Duterte Administration has made many significant milestones that have benefitted our nation: from his decisive leadership, to the projects that commenced and completed under his watch, to the many programs that have improved the lives especially of those who need our help the most — the poor, the needy, the hopeless, and the helpless —all of them being our priority in our endeavors in public service,” added Go. 

Central to his candidacy, Go said, are the principles of continuity, compassion or “malasakit,” and genuine service that Duterte has taught him for more than two decades of working with him.
